Saints vs. Falcons Week 13 Odds
ATLANTA, GA (The Spread) – One of the best matchups in Week 13 will take place tonight when the Falcons host the Saints at 8:20PM ET. Let’s check out the odds for this contest.

NEW ORLEANS: The Saints had their three-game winning streak snapped last Sunday in a 31-21 loss to the 49ers. It was the first time that New Orleans lost in three weeks and it was also the first time they failed to cover over that same span. Drew Brees completed 26-of-41 passes for 267 yards with three touchdowns but was also intercepted twice in the game, which were both returned for touchdowns by San Francisco. The loss dropped the Saints to 5-6 on the year and 6-5 against the spread as they failed to cover as a 1-point home underdog. The over covered for the second time in their last three games and is now 7-4 in all New Orleans’ games this year.
ATLANTA: The Falcons beat the Buccaneers 24-23 to run their record to 10-1 on the season. Like much of the season, quarterback Matt Ryan was spectacular while completing 26-of-32 passes for 353 yards with one touchdown and one interception. Julio Jones also caught six passes for a career-high 147 yards and one 80-yard touchdown pass. Jacquizz Rodgers also provided a spark in the running game, as he rushed 10 times for 49 yards and a touchdown. The Falcons are now 6-4-1 against the spread after pushing as a 1-point favorite, although they haven’t cover the spread since a 19-13 win over the Cowboys four weeks ago. Ryan leads the team with 3,425 passing yards while Michael Turner has a team-high 595 rushing yards and seven total touchdowns.
ODDS: According to oddsmakers from online sports book Bovada.lv, the Falcons are 3.5-point favorites versus the Saints, while the over/under total is currently sitting at 56 points. New Orleans enters the game with a 5-6 record overall and a 2-3 record on the road, while Atlanta is 10-1 overall and 5-0 at home.
TRENDS: The Saints are 4-0 against the spread in their last four games versus the Falcons, while the underdog is 6-1 ATS in the last seven meetings. The over is also 7-3 in the last 10 meetings between these two teams.
